Migraine with typical aura, also known as classic migraine or migraine with aura, is a neurological condition characterized by recurrent episodes of intense headache accompanied by distinct sensory experiences known as aura. It is a specific subtype of migraines, a common type of headache disorder.

    A typical aura refers to a series of transient and reversible symptoms that precede or accompany the headache phase of a migraine attack. These symptoms typically develop gradually over a period of several minutes and last for about 20 minutes to an hour. Visual disturbances are the most common type of aura experienced, such as seeing flashing lights, zigzag lines, or blind spots. Some individuals may also experience sensory disturbances, such as tingling or numbness in the face or limbs, or difficulty speaking.

    The aura phase is usually followed by a severe headache that can last for several hours or even days. The headache is typically characterized by throbbing or pulsating pain, often on one side of the head. Other associated symptoms may include nausea, vomiting, sensitivity to light and sound, and fatigue.

    The exact cause of migraine with typical aura is not fully understood, but several factors contribute to its development, including genetics, hormonal changes, certain foods or drinks, sleep disturbances, stress, and environmental factors. Treatment options for migraine with typical aura include preventive medications, pain-relieving medications, lifestyle modifications, and avoiding triggers.
